Clyde E. Teal

September 26, 1904 — November 6, 2010

Clyde E. Teal, 106, of Orange, Texas died Saturday, November 6, 2010, at Christus St. Elizabeth Hospital in Beaumont.

Funeral services will be 10:00 a.m. Wednesday, November 10, 2010, at First United Pentecostal Church in Orange. Officiating will be Reverend Gary Wheeler. Burial will follow at Wilkinson Cemetery in Orange.
Visitation will be from 5:00-9:00 p.m., Tuesday at Claybar Funeral Home in Orange.

Born in Orange, Texas on September 26, 1904, Clyde was the son of Emma Hilliard and Eugene Lester Teal. He served in the National Guard during World War II. Also, Clyde owned and operated Teal Construction.

He was preceded in death by his first wife, Martha Teal; second wife, Mildred Teal; sons, Clyde Teal, Jr., Elmore Teal; step-son, Windell Fruge; step-grandson, Randy Marshall; and several brothers and sisters.

Clyde is survived by his sons and daughters-in-law, Lee and Mary Teal of Waco, David and Kim Teal of Harker Heights, Jim and Carolyn Teal of Fayett, Missouri; daughter, Myna Morris of Brady; step-daughters, Lidwyn Marshall and her husband Pat, and Sherry Huckaby, all of Orange; and step-son, Dean Dyson and his wife Anita, also of Orange.

He is also survived by numerous grandchildren, great-grandchildren and great great-grandchildren; and sisters, Ruth Hobden of Deweyville, and Myna Stewart of Missouri City.

Serving as Pallbearers will be John Morris, Bill Morris, Mike Morris, Josh Dyson, Jason Dyson, and Terry Huckaby.
